David L. Danner, President Dr. Danner founded IDEAMATICS, Inc. in 1975 and has spent the past four decades providing consulting services to commercial clients and government agencies. He has developed complex information systems, implemented sophisticated computer models, designed computer hardware, analyzed business processes and requirements, evaluated procedures and methodologies, prepared appraisals, conducted studies for resource management, assessed potential metrics for system operation and taught productivity improvement. Along with Dr. Danner's Bachelor of Science in Industrial Engineering from Purdue University, and Bachelor of Science in Oceanography from George Washington University, he also has received a Master of Science in Industrial Engineering from Purdue University as well as a PH.D. in Systems Engineering from Catholic University of America. He is a registered Professional Engineer, holds a patent in computer telephony and has published extensively as well as serving as an expert witness in several jurisdictions. Dr. Danner is a Fellow of the Washington Academy of Sciences. |
Michael A. Schwartz, Vice President Mr. Schwartz has demonstrated design and programming experience with stand-alone applications, multi-tier web applications, and mobile platform applications development. Earning an MBA in 2009, Mr. Schwartz’s graduate studies have enhanced his management skills, especially with software development teams. His combination of business and technical skills are demonstrated with his management activities for the Navy-Marine Corps Mobilization Processing System (NMCMPS) and the U.S. Coast Guard Mobilization Readiness Tracking Tool (MRTT) projects. He was promoted to Vice President of IDEAMATICS, Inc. in 2008. Mr. Schwartz holds a Bachelors of Science in Computer Science from James Madison University as well as an M.B.A. in Technology Management from University of Phoenix. |
Mark A. Moore, Vice President of Operations Mr. Moore brings to IDEAMATICS over twenty years of challenging technical, managerial and leadership expertise in the U.S. Navy as a former Mobilization and Plans Officer at Headquarters United Marine Corps, as well as experience as a Reserve Liaison Officer (RLO), and extensive service in the United States Navy’s Training and Administration of Reserves Officer (TAR) and Full Time Support Officer (FTS) and Supply Corps Officer Communities. He is uniquely qualified by virtue of his exposure to and familiarity with both U.S. Navy and U.S. Marine Corps mobilization systems and policies. Mr. Moore holds a Bachelors of Science in Business Administration from Old Dominion University, a M.S.A.ED in Education, Technology & Leadership from The George Washington University, an M.S.Ed. in Education from Old Dominion University as well as becoming certified a Project Management Professional (PMP) in 2013. |
John R. Kaplar, Vice President of Software Solutions Mr. Kaplar has applied superior software development and analyst skills as a member of the IDEAMATICS team since 2005. He has extensive experience with managing development teams, having served as the Technical Team Lead for our Navy, Coast Guard, and Marine Corps contingency workforce management projects. Mr. Kaplar holds the (ISC)2, Inc. Certified Secure Software Lifecycle Professional (CSSLP) certification, the CompTIA Security+ certification, Micropact's entellitrak Developer certification, and the Microsoft Certified Solutions Developer (MCSD) App Builder certification. Mr. Kaplar holds a Bachelor of Science in Computer Science and Mathematics from the Christopher Newport University as well as a Masters of Engineering in Computer Science from the University of Colorado. |
Brian K. Morgan, Director of Strategic Initiatives Dr. Morgan joined the team during 2013 to explore new strategic directions for IDEAMATICS and develop the business opportunities to achieve our corporate goals. Dr. Morgan brings over thirty years of challenging management, planning and strategic leadership expertise in the U.S. Marine Corps. His military assignments included seven years in Headquarters, U.S. Marine Corps serving in both the Manpower department and the Plans, Policy and Operations department. He also served in a variety of operational planning and strategy development positions at Camp Lejeune, NC and Camp Pendleton, CA. He has maintained an ongoing and rigorous academic regimen as both a student and an instructor, and has been twice published as a contributing author to the Marine Corps Gazette. Dr. Morgan holds a Bachelors of Arts in English from University of Pennsylvania, an M.A. in Human Resource Management from National University, an M.S. in Strategic Studies from U.S. Army War College. Dr. Morgan completed his Doctorate from George Washington University in Human and Organizational Learning in September 2015. |
